one. Introduction to URL Shortening
URL shortening is a method over the internet through which a long URL could be converted right into a shorter, much more workable sort. This shortened URL redirects to the original prolonged URL when visited. Companies like Bitly and TinyURL are very well-acknowledged examples of URL shorteners. The need for URL shortening arose with the arrival of social websites platforms like Twitter, wherever character boundaries for posts manufactured it hard to share extended URLs.

Beyond social websites, URL shorteners are valuable in marketing campaigns, e-mail, and printed media in which extensive URLs could be cumbersome.

two. Main Components of a URL Shortener
A URL shortener normally is made of the following parts:

Internet Interface: Here is the front-finish component the place end users can enter their prolonged URLs and acquire shortened variations. It might be a simple variety on the web page.
Database: A databases is necessary to retail store the mapping involving the first long URL as well as the shortened Model. Databases like MySQL, PostgreSQL, or NoSQL options like MongoDB can be used.
Redirection Logic: Here is the backend logic that usually takes the brief URL and redirects the user towards the corresponding very long URL. This logic is often executed in the online server or an software layer.
API: Many URL shorteners provide an API so that 3rd-bash apps can programmatically shorten URLs and retrieve the initial very long URLs.
3. Designing the URL Shortening Algorithm
The crux of the URL shortener lies in its algorithm for changing a protracted URL into a short a single. Numerous strategies may be used, which include:

Hashing: The extended URL is often hashed into a fixed-dimension string, which serves because the limited URL. On the other hand, hash collisions (various URLs leading to the same hash) must be managed.
Base62 Encoding: One particular common method is to make use of Base62 encoding (which takes advantage of 62 people: 0-9, A-Z, in addition to a-z) on an integer ID. The ID corresponds on the entry during the database. This method makes sure that the limited URL is as small as possible.
Random String Generation: One more method is always to make a random string of a hard and fast duration (e.g., six people) and Test if it’s presently in use from the databases. Otherwise, it’s assigned to the extended URL.
4. Databases Administration
The databases schema for a URL shortener is generally simple, with two Main fields:

ID: A unique identifier for every URL entry.
Long URL: The initial URL that should be shortened.
Short URL/Slug: The brief Model of your URL, frequently saved as a singular string.
In addition to these, you may want to keep metadata including the creation date, expiration date, and the amount of periods the shorter URL continues to be accessed.

5. Dealing with Redirection
Redirection can be a significant part of the URL shortener's Procedure. Every time a person clicks on a brief URL, the company needs to quickly retrieve the original URL from the database and redirect the user utilizing an HTTP 301 (long lasting redirect) or 302 (short term redirect) standing code.

Overall performance is essential right here, as the procedure ought to be approximately instantaneous. Methods like databases indexing and caching (e.g., using Redis or Memcached) is often employed to speed up the retrieval course of action.

6. Safety Things to consider
Security is a major worry in URL shorteners:

Destructive URLs: A URL shortener may be abused to unfold destructive hyperlinks. Implementing URL validation, blacklisting, or integrating with third-social gathering stability solutions to check URLs ahead of shortening them can mitigate this hazard.
Spam Avoidance: Price limiting and CAPTCHA can avoid abuse by spammers looking to crank out thousands of brief URLs.
7. Scalability
Because the URL shortener grows, it may have to manage an incredible number of URLs and redirect requests. This needs a scalable architecture, quite possibly involving load balancers, dispersed databases, and microservices.

Load Balancing: Distribute website traffic throughout many servers to manage significant masses.
Distributed Databases: Use databases that will scale horizontally, like Cassandra or MongoDB.
Microservices: Independent issues like URL shortening, analytics, and redirection into various solutions to improve scalability and maintainability.
eight. Analytics
URL shorteners generally give analytics to track how often a brief URL is clicked, wherever the targeted traffic is coming from, and also other beneficial metrics. This demands logging Every redirect and possibly integrating with analytics platforms.
